COURT RESPONSES TO COVID-19ILLINOIS COURTS INFORMATION ON COVID-19 - PLEASE CLICK THIS LINK FOR UP-TO-DATE INFORMATIONState of Illinois Response to COVID-19 The Illinois Judges Association consists of over 1250 current and retired judges. The Association supports judicial excellence and professional development and judicial education, fosters public confidence in an independent judiciary, works to preserve the independence of the judiciary by educating the public and students, and promotes a diverse judiciary that administers justice in a fair and impartial court system.
